Since the publication by Health and Safety Executive (HSE) of HSG 258 ‘Controlling Airborne Contaminants at Work – a guide to local exhaust ventilation (LEV)’ many diligent industry owners are insisting that LEV work is only undertaken by engineers who have attained suitable training courses to ensure their systems fall within legislative guidelines.
Understand why you might need an LEV System.
The main use case of dust extraction, fume extraction or local ventilation systems are in high risk environments.
This includes industries such as manufacturing, woodworking, pharmaceuticals, automotive and chemical processing and more, where it’s important to keep the air clean and breathable.
The UK’s regulatory framework enforces strict health and safety standards in workplaces, including compliance with the Control of Substances Hazardous to Health (COSHH) regulations.
To meet these requirements, Local Exhaust Ventilation (LEV) systems are often necessary to manage exposure to hazardous substances. Businesses are responsible for assessing risks and implementing suitable control measures.
